A WARNING
- Read and follow all WARNINGS c> A in Gen-
eral description on page 32.
- After closing the luggage compartment lid,
always pull up on it to make sure that it is
properly closed . Otherwise
it cou ld open
suddenly when the veh icle is moving .
- To help prevent poisonous exhaust gas from
being drawn into the veh icle, always keep
the luggage compartment lid closed while
dr iving . Never t ransport objects larger than
those which fit completely into t he luggage
area, because t hen the luggage compart-
ment lid cannot be fully closed .
- Never leave yo ur vehicle unattended espe-
cially with t he luggage comp a rtment lid left
open. A child could crawl into the car
through the luggage compartment and pull
the lid shut, becoming trapped and unable
to get out. To reduce the risk of personal in-
jury, never let children p lay in or around
you r vehicle. Always keep the luggage com-
partment lid as well as the vehicle doors
closed when not in use .
- Never close the luggage compartment lid
inatten ti vely or without check ing first . Al-
though the clos ing fo rce of the luggage
compartment lid is limited, yo u can st ill se-
riously injure yourse lf or others.

- Always ensure that no one is within range of
the luggage compartment lid when it is
mov ing, in particular close to the hinges and
the upper and lower edges - fingers or
hands can be pinched.
- Never try to interfere with the luggage com-
partment lid or help it when it is be ing
opened or closed a utomat ically.

- If there is a mechanical problem with auto-
matic closing for the luggage compartment
lid or the re is an obs t ruction, it opens again
immediately . Check to see why the luggage
compartment lid could not be closed before
attempting t o close it again.
- The following applies to vehicles equ ipped
with the Convenience key* feature: if the re-
mote contro l key is left in the lugg age com-
partment, luggage compartmen t will auto-
matically unlock itself after you lock the ve-
hicle. This prevents you from unintentiona l-
ly locking you r key in the luggage compart-
ment.
- When the vehicle is locked, the luggage
compartment lid can be unlocked separately
by pressing the button~ on the master
key. When t he luggage compartment lid is
closed aga in, it locks automat ica lly.
- If the vehicle battery charge drops below a
certain level, you can still open or close the
luggage compa rtment lid manually, howev-
er, you will need to apply mo re force to
close it .
